我有一个使用Delphi 2006编写的应用程序,并带有一个CHM帮助文件。除了无法让“打开对话框”(TOpenDialog)和“保存对话框”(TSaveDialog)上的“帮助”按钮连接到帮助文件外,一切都运行正常。 下面是一个简单的演示程序。单击按钮2可以打开帮助文件并显示正确的页面。单...
有哪些适用于创建面向最终用户的跨平台帮助文件的良好作者工具?(我们的应用程序正在使用Qt框架,如果这有任何区别的话。) 注意:我不感兴趣内部API文档-我们正在使用doxygen。 理想情况下,解决方案应该: 允许我们在单一位置管理所有帮助内容(文本、目录、图片等)。 输出到本地帮助格...
微软的CHM格式非常好,它提供了以下功能: 带有树形视图的目录。 索引。 基于HTML源代码的索引搜索。 但这种格式已经过时并且存在许多缺点: 存在安全问题(允许执行JavaScript代码)。 不了解新的HTML格式。 没有文档记录。 不能正确处理不同的字符编码(如UTF-8)。 是否有任...
我正在使用 XML文档注释 记录一个程序集,使用 Sandcastle 创建 chm 文件。 我的程序集包含各种接口,每个接口都由一个类实现(在我的情况下是WCF服务)。 我已经为这些接口添加了文档,是否有办法自动记录实现类中相关的方法?
我是C#的新手,正在开发一个工具来验证帮助文件中主题ID的内容。以下函数对我启动帮助文件很有用: Help.ShowHelp(this, HelpFile.Text, HelpNavigator.TopicId, topicIDStr); 如果Help.ShowHelp()函数无法使用...
我是一名有用的助手,可以为您翻译以下内容: 我正在尝试使用C#打开一个CHM文件并跳转到特定主题。 我已经尝试使用 Help.ShowHelp(this, path, HelpNavigator.Topic, "TopicTitle"); 但是它找不到页面。我一定没有正确输入主题标题。...
我已使用以下链接生成了 Web API 的 Swagger 文档: http://wmpratt.com/swagger-and-asp-net-web-api-part-1/ 需要将文档导出为 PDF 或 XML 文件,以便随身携带发送。 这是 .NET WEB API。 如何导出 S...
我刚刚从http://us2.php.net/download-docs.php下载了php_manual.en.chm文件,但它无法使用。 每当我打开这个文件时,就会看到以下信息: 导航到网页被取消。 你可以尝试以下操作: Retype the address. 我正在使用Windo...
我在HTML帮助工作室中创建了一个项目。当我打开帮助(/chm)应用程序时,可以看到目录。默认情况下,文件中的第一个条目被选中。 然而,我无法看到相应的页面数据,而是能够看到"This program cannot display the web page"(IE7中默认的错误消息)。只有当...